HISTORY
Insulation oil purification and drying
plants for transformers

In the course of restructuration of the vacuum plants division of ABB Switzerland AG, Micafil, the newly formed company
Micafluid AG took over the entire product line of oil purification plants in 2006 under a mutual agreement. Since all rights and
technology were transferred as well, Micafluid was able to profit from a development and research back-ground of 95 years, on
which Micafil had based their strong reputation.

In order to provide for a long-term operational safety on power transformers, it will be of decisive importance to maintain the
humidity content of the oil and the entire dielectric system as low as this is possible and economically justifiable. Worldwide
investigations lead to conclusions that a higher percentage of the investigated power transformers operate with increased
moisture content in the oil in the solid insulation. Depending on the total quantity of insulating materials, the operating tem-
perature, service intervals, size, voltage rating and age of the transformer as well as the measured moisture content, users
and service organisations must decide on the most appropriate technological approach for servicing the unit. Factors that in
the end will influence any decision, such as available capital investment, drying efficiency of a system, required operating
personnel, operating and maintenance costs, must carefully be taken into consideration before deciding on the appropriate
purification and drying technology.

REOIL
TRANSFORMER OIL REGENERATION
TECHNOLOGY

In 1996, Ekofluid organization was established as an engineering and servicing firm with focus in transformer
oil precessing fields.

Why „Oil Processing Technologies“? There are many fields where the different kinds of oils are used.

One of the biggest users of oils - power industry - in power and distribution transformers serve as huge market
for some of these technologies.
It is fact that the life of a transformer is the life of the insulation system. Knowing also what can happen

to service-aged transformer oil, the problem as whole can be put into one question:

What needs to be done?

It is known that the mineral oil in millions of transformers proveds:

 delectric strength of insulation system

 Efficient cooling

 Protection of the transformer core from chemical attack

 Prevention of the build-up of sludge in the transformer

When the properties of oil have changed - the oil can no longer perform - the continued operation of the

transformer will significantly reduce the life-time of the transformer insulation. Under such circumstances
oil has to be changed or treated.

Treatment methods:

1. OIL PURIFICATION

In the process of Purification, water dirt and gases are removed from transformer oil. Regular

Purification will increase breakdown voltage (kV) to required level. Oil Purification is an effective

Preventive maintenance method.

2. OIL REGENERATION

When oil in transformer, due to deterioration,reaches a stage where purification is no longer efficient, oil

has to be changed or regenerated. Adsorption clay is the material most frequently used for regenerating

of oils. This is a naturally occurring clay with a huge adsorbent properties as a result of high surface

activity. Regeneration is the complete treatment of oil to like new condition. Regeneration of oil

„in atransformer“ is far more efficient than simple oil change. The total volume of oil is recirculated a

number of times thorough the regeneration plant and „flusching effect“ of transformer is achieved.

It is obvious that regeneration as complete oil treatment methos is the best technical solution to aged

transformer oil. Apart from this it is also highly cost effective in comparison to an old procedure of oil

change.
WHAT DISTINGUISH EKOFLUID - REOIL TECHNOLOGY FROM
EXISTING DISPOSABLE ADSORPTION MATERIAL TECHNOLOGY

Both technologies use a naturally occurring mineral to regenerate transformer oil

Existing old technology will use adsorption clay only once - then it has to be disposed of, with oil and

contaminants trapped inside. So large quantities of adsorption clay are required and after regeneration

waste, in th form of oil clay saturate with contaminants, has to be taken away and be disposed of

Ekofluid technology is based on activated adsorption clay being permanently installed in regenration
columns.

When clay, after certain time of Regeneration is no longer efficient “Readsorption“ will take place.

There is no need to remove clay from the plant. This unique system allows up to 300 readsorptions

of the activated adsorption clay before it has to be cheaply disposed of as a non-hazardous substance.

How is it possible? What is the menaing of “readsorption“?

As it was said, after certain time when regeneration is no longer efficient and clay is saturated ba

contaminants “special precedure - readsorbtion“ will bring activated clay to ist original state.

After comparing these two technologies there is an obvious advantage : Saturated clay by contaminants

does not have to be disposed of as a hazardous substance. This results in 300 times less consumption

of clay and above all, technology becomes environmentally friendly and higly cost effective.

TECHNICAL PART
EKOFLUID MOBILE TRANSFORMER OIL REGENERATION PLANT

The most effective method of transformer oil regeneration is on site and within transformer. The trailer -

mounted mobile regeneration plant has been designed specifically for on-site use to completely regenerate

insulating oils. Although the unit was designed so that it could be moved from one transformer site to

another , its versatility and efficiency has not been compromised by its mobility. Transformer oil can be

regenerated on-site in energized or de-energized transformers. The unit incorporates option for regular oil

purification - degassing and filtration - but its main application is in the removal of acidity,sludge and

other soluble oil decay products while leaving the oil in the quality exceeding requirements of

international standards for new transformer oil.The concept of oil regeneration on-site is highly cost

effective. There is no need to bring fresh adsorption clay and remove quantities of oily saturated clay

away from site.Plants control system offers the highest standard of safety and reliability. Since

regeneration is done on-site and within a particular transformer , the chances of spillage of oil during oil

change and oil transport are eliminated. Ekofluid`s continuous oil regeneration process is environmentally

safe.

BASIC TECHNICAL DATA

Electrical supply : 380 / 420 V 3 - ph 50 Hz

Effluent : Air & neutral gases

Inlet filter : 30 micron porosity nominally rated

Fine filter : 0.5 micron porosity nominally rated

Electric heater : Utilized low watt density heater ( 1.7 watt/sqcm) with total capacity of 80 kW

Clay treatment : Total of 1 500 kg of Fullers Earth within percolation filters providing "Readsorb process"

Plant control : Reoil system is controlled by Programmable Logic Controller (PLC) and interfaced with a

Supervisory Control and Data Acquisition (SCADA) computer system.

Due to used computer systems two operators only are required for set-up. Once the system is

engaged only one operator is required to monitor the system.


GUARANTEED PERFORMANCES OF REGENERATED OIL

IEC Limits After Regeneration

Electric Strength IEC 156 30 kV 80 kV

Water Content IEC 733 30 ppm 5 ppm

Neutralization number IEC 296 0,03 mg KOH/g 0,03 mg KOH/g

Dielectric Dissipation Factor @ 90 C IEC 247 0.005 0.003

Interfacial Tension ISO 6295 40 mN/m 45 mN/m

PERFORMANCE OF PLANT AND ECONOMICAL GUIDE

Plant efficiency : 5 000 L of regenerated oil per each reactivation ( ~ 5 000 L per day )

Plant capacity per year : 900 000 L

Estimated practical use of plant per year : 500 000 L

Estimated price of regenerated transformer oil : 0.7 - 0.8 EURO / L


( price of new transformer oil : ~1,5 – 2 EURO / L )
OIL REGENERATION UNIT TPYE, CRP3000
Working principle

The fuller and inhibition plant type CRP-3000 is a regeneration plant, which is used together with an oil treatment
plant of adequate design and capacity. Its inflow is taken immediately after the oil heater and the regenerated oil
is directed back into the oil treatment plant right before the fine filter. Between the two connections (in-flow and
return flow) a manual stop valve will be incorporated. Connection between oil plant and regeneration plant via
flexible hoses.
During treatment, a part of the treated oil (3000 lt/h) flows over two fuller's tanks switched in parallel, whilst the
rest flows directly to the fine filter over the added manual valve (stop cock).
Oil feeding and heating-up is carried out by inlet gear pump and oil heater of the oil treatment plant
respectively.

The final oil filtration is effectuated in the fine filter of the oil treatment plant, thus preventing fuller's earth particles
from entering the oil. When the treatment and regeneration processes are completed, during the last oil pass, the
oil treatment plant is switched over to the transformer to be filled and in addition the inhibition tank item 4 is
switched parallel to the main oil circuit, so that the inhibitor may gradually be
dissolved and conducted into the main oil volume.
A part of the oil (800 lt/h) thus flows over two inhibition tanks items 4, and the remainder oil flows directly to the
fine filter via the additionally incorporated manual valve.

After several passes (between 10-15) the clay become saturated and must be changed.The two columns are
movable by hydraulic unit for easy embty the clay. With optional vacuum system with drum heater new clay
can be refilled.

Multispectral Ultrasound
Online Transformer Oil
Measuring Device Type TranSCoM X3

The TranSCoM technology has been developed during the last years by the scientists of the partner of
Micafluid AG, the new company Yucoya Energy Safety GmbH

With its outstanding multi-frequent ultrasound technology Yucoya Energy Safety GmbH is targeting at the pulsating heart of our
industrialized world—the electrical grid. The company aims especially at the power transformers in the grid whose safe function-
ing is a necessary precondition of a seamless supply of the modern society with electrical energy.

Fig.1: Measurement cell MF-100M with transducers MF-3-AL.

The technology developed by Yucoya Energy Safety GmbH can be described as applied molecular acoustics. The meaning of this
terminus is that ultrasonic waves are interacting with e.g. fluids on a molecular level. During a research period of over 15 years it
could be found out by the scientists of Yucoya Energy Safety GmbH that the ultrasound velocity in a fluid is not a constant but
slightly changing with frequency even for low frequencies (1-10 MHz). The multi-frequent ultrasound technology of Yucoya Energy
Safety GmbH takes advantage from these changes by providing a frequency-dependent acoustical spectrum with a bundle of ult-
rasound parameters for the fluid in real-time.

Thus it is possible to „grasp“ fast reacting chemical processes for some dominant variables. On the other side it is also easily pos-
sible to „grasp“ processes only moderately changing in time with a lot of variables involved.
The ageing of transformer oils for instance is such a process. Consequently—the first real-world application of the molecular-
acoustic technology of Yucoya Energy Safety GmbH is the detection of three relevant oil parameters, BDV, DDF and water content,
in transformer oils by the system TranSCoM X3.

What is TranSCoM X3?

„TranSCoM X3“ denotes Transformer – oil Safety Condition and Monitoring for three (3) transformer oil parameters.

TranSCoM X3 is the first implementation of TranSCoM technology in a strictly industrial application – the purification and regene-
ration of transformer oil by VOP plants from Micafluid AG. In this combination of technologies TranSCoM X3 is fulfilling the task of
measuring the quality of the purified or regenerated oil during the corresponding VOP process. This task is carried out in a conti-
nuous measuring mode, realtime and online.

The measurement principle of TranSCoM X3 is illustrated


in Fig.3. The measured raw ultrasound data for at least 26
frequencies are analyzed by the HiPer TransQM measuring
device. The results are characteristic ultrasound parameters
of the oil for each frequency. These parameters like ult-
rasound velocity, phase differences or attenuation are for-
warded to an industrial PC (IPC) or LapTop with equivalent
power and safety features. In this evaluation unit the cur-
rently measured ultrasound parameters are compared to
those, which were measured together with oil parameters in
advance and were stored in a data base, which is the „core“
of TranSCoM X3. A sophisticated software (inference engi-
ne) provides the linkage to the oil parameters, stored in the
data base as well. As a result trends of each oil parameter
are displayed either on the IPC or a separate screen em-
bedded in the VOP from Micafluid AG.

Instrument for Measuring the
Electric Resistivity on Oil Samples

VZ220A

Introduction

The measuring instrument type VZ220A conforms to the new IEC 61620 standard
This insturment is based on the so-called „low amplitude, low frequency, alternate square wave method“ and
permits accurate measurement of volume conductivity and relative permittivity. The measurement of volume
conductivity in the range of 0.01 pS/m to 20‘000 pS/m allows the use of this instrument for quality assessment
of high resistive liquids even at ambient temperature.

The VZ220A works with low voltage and low current levels and represents no danger at all for its operators.
Measuring method
The liquid in the test cell is excited with a low amplitude (30 V) low frequncy (0.5 Hz)
alternate square
wave voltage without any DC component (see figure 1).

Figure 1
By measuring the current through the liquid the capacitance C and the conductance G can be determined
and the values of relative permittivity εr and volume conductivity σ are given according to the following
equations:

εr = C/Co
σ = εo.G/Co

The derived dissipation factor tanδ for a given frequency f can be determined according to the following
equation:

tanδ = G/C·2ттf

For determination of conductivity or tanδ, the alternate square wave method is, by far, more sensitive than
the classic bridge method. It permits the determination of conductivity values down to 0.01 pS/m respectively
tanδ values down to 1E-6 (at 50 Hz). This high sensitivity allows accurate measurements of conductivity and
tanδ at low temperatures and consequently the characterization of liquids at room temperature can be
carried out with confidence.

Test cell
The application of a square wave excitation voltage with low amplitude of only ±30 V permits the develop-
ment of a test cell with simple design, easy to use and to clean. The compact test cell of the LCM-8716 is
composed of only two parts, a container and an active part. Two coaxial electrodes (stainless steel) are
attached on a cap (also stainless steel). This cap also supports two BNC connectors coupled to the two
electrodes. The electrodes possess a clean, polished surface. The vessel and the active part can be
cleaned according to procedures described in the appendix A. It is not possible and not necessary to
disassemble the active part for cleaning purposes.
The required amount of liquid for a test is about 210 ml. To reach this amount, fill in the liquid to be tested up
to 23 mm from the top edge of the vessel.
The temperature of the tested liquid can be determined by introducing the electronic thermometer in the cell
through the cover orifice.
Application

A typical application of VZ220A is the quality assessment of mineral oil used in high voltage apparatus e.g.
power and instrument transformers, bushings, capacitors, etc.

Several investigations have demonstrated that the conductivity of oil is influenced by impurities and ionic
components, which are introduced in it. Therefore, the oil condutivity charaterizes well the quality of oil.

Further, it has been shown that the moisture in oil has no significant influence on its conductivity.
The following values of conductivity given at ambient temperature are typical for a mineral oil in its different
states of use.

- New oil (laboratory quality) ≤ 0.05 pS/m


- New oil (industrial quality) 0.05...0.1 pS/m
- Light used oil in good condition 0.1...1.0 pS/m
- Middle used oil in acceptable condition 1.0...5.0 pS/m
- Heavily used oil in bad condition > 5.0 pS/m

HOT OIL SPRAY PLANT
(TYPE HOS)
The Hot Oil Spray process allows for active part drying within a transformer’s own shell or tank. Owning to its simple
but effective process, we can both decrease service time and costs while increasing flexibility within the field.
Micafluid’s HOS systems provide compact solutions that can be used to dry various transformers, ranging from 40
MVA up to 400 MVA with the possibility of being used in conjunction with LFH.

HOS in SIX steps

1. Setup of spray system


The number and location of the spray nozzles are selected to ensure sufficient oil flow and
uniform spray coverage over the entire top area of the active part. The system should be mounted
as close to the tank cover as possible.
2. Vacuum test
A leak test should be performed on the transformer tank. Any existing leaks should be sealed
before proceeding to the next step.
3. Hot Oil Spray
While under vacuum, the transformer needs to be filled to the specified level. Oil circulation is then
made between the pump, filter, heater and transformer tank.
After the temperature has reached the process setpoint, it has to be incremented and held at each
step until reaching the maximum specified temperature.
The process end is then determined by the final parameter values (Time, Pressure & Temperature).
4. Oil drainage
Once Hot Oil Spray has been completed, all oil is drained from the trans former in
to the “used” oil storage tank.
5. Vacuum drying
Fine vacuum has to be applied and held
during the specified time, ensuring the
extraction of any remaining moisture.
6. Oil impregnation
Once the vacuum drying cycle has been
completed, oil filling can be started.
